Parameter | Description | Value |
---|---|---|
file-name |
Specifies the storage path and file name of a patch package. The path name is an absolute path name or a relative path name. |
The value is a string of 5 to 127 case-sensitive characters without spaces. The value of the patch name is a string of 5 to 63 characters. |
all |
Installs patches on all boards. |
- |
run |
Runs a patch after the patch is loaded. |
- |
Usage Scenario
Before loading a patch, the system resolves the patch package to check the validity of patch files and obtain the attributes of patch files.
When loading a patch to the current system, the system searches the patch package for a matching patch file according to the attributes of the patch file.
Prerequisites
The desired patch file has been uploaded to the main control board of the device.
Configuration Impact
If you continue to install the patch when the CPU or memory usage is too high, risks exist.
After loading a cold patch, restart the device to make the patch take effect.
After the patch load command is run, the system loads all types of patches in the patch package. If the run parameter is specified, the system runs the loaded patches directly.
Precautions
This command applies only to the admin VS but takes effect on all VSs.
